So, it's been a few days and I noticed my Camponotus subbarbatus colony that had 7 workers went to 6...dunno why but good news is today as I was hooking them up to their new custom made outworld, I noticed the first worker of the year has arrived! She is sooo pale/clear. I would take pictures but rather not as I disturbed them enough moving their test tube and everything. I will take some though maybe tomorrow. Also, the single queen I had founding, she had a small like if eggs and 1 big larvae...checked on her yesterday and the larvae is gone. I wasn't sure if she had enough reserves left to do another batch from scratch so I let her and her brood go. I hope she has a comeback... The other colony with 3 workers is a little behind in brood growth but seem to be doing ok as well.
